Recent events in our community and across the nation have focused on the existence of systemic racism. Therefore, we will conduct the June 29th Equity and Mobility Advisory Committee (EMAC) meeting as a listening session. Committee members can come together to share their thoughts and experiences.
The EMAC works to prioritize equity and mobility in designing the I-205 and I-5 Toll Projects. This committee is a group of individuals with professional or lived experience in equity and mobility coming together to advise the Oregon Transportation Commission and ODOT on how tolls on I-205 and I-5 freeways, in combination with other demand management strategies, can include benefits for populations that have historically and currently been underrepresented or underserved by transportation projects.
